To determine the single discount equivalent to three successive discounts of 10%, 20%, and 25%, we need to calculate the cumulative effect of these discounts on the original price. Let's assume the original price is 100 units. 1. First Discount (10%): - After a 10% discount, the price becomes 90 units. (Calculation: 100 - 10% of 100 = 100 - 10 = 90) 2.
